An Alberta agency is seeking expert services for the implementation and development of SharePoint site architecture and records management. The selected vendor will provide comprehensive guidance, analysis, design, and planning to support the creation of an enterprise SharePoint information architecture, as well as the implementation of an agency-wide records management framework.
Key responsibilities include assessing current departmental practices, legacy drives, and existing SharePoint sites, as well as reviewing the lifecycle of digital records across systems such as SharePoint, Laserfiche, Teams, and email. The vendor will design a scalable, departmental and function-based SharePoint folder and library structure suitable for replacing network drives. Recommendations will be provided on metadata models, naming conventions, and classification elements to enhance records findability and retention compliance.
Additional tasks involve developing governance standards and documentation for SharePoint and Microsoft 365, preparing a migration strategy and implementation roadmap, and identifying opportunities for automation. All deliverables must comply with the Municipal Government Act, Access to Information Act, Protection of Privacy Act, and evolving legislative requirements under the agency’s Privacy Management Program. The contract duration is one year.
